  2. The District of Columbia Public Schools (DCPS) is the local public school system for Washington, D.C. It is distinct from the District of Columbia Public Charter Schools (DCPCS), which governs public charter schools in the city.

  9. Jun 22, 2024 · District Of Columbia Public Schools is an above average, public school district located in WASHINGTON, DC. It has 49,687 students in grades PK, K-12 with a student-teacher ratio of 11 to 1. According to state test scores, 22% of students are at least proficient in math and 35% in reading.
